Which Is the Most Convenient Airport to South Hackensack, NJ?

I'll be traveling from either LAX or Burbank, CA, to South Hackensack,NJ, early/mid March for business and I'm trying to determine which airport to fly into. I will need to rent a car at the airport. Looks like LaGuardia is 11 miles away and Newark is 14, but closest isn't always the most convenient. Also, is there anywhere I should visit in or around South Hackensack during my downtime? Newark is the best option since it's in the same state and it avoids having to drive through or around Manhattan. The logical answer to your second question is Manhattan, but perhaps if we knew a bit more about you we can advise you better. There's loads of shopping in/near Hackensack. There are some beautiful views of the Hudson River along the Palisades in that area and walking/running trails.

LGA may be fewer miles away - but it's across two rivers - the crossings of which are often heavily backed up.

Newark is the obvious choice.

Have you looked at a map - I strongly suggest it. You will need to rent a car to get around NJ - which is very suburban.

If you're trying to locate a hotel that would be both convenient to that bindery and also good to get to/from Manhattan in the evening, the best option is the Sheraton Lincoln Harbor in Weehawken, NJ. It's directly across from midtown Manhattan and during the week there's a ferry right in front of the hotel that goes across the Hudson to Manhattan. On the Manhattan side, the ferry co nywaterway.com has a free shuttle bus that will take you to various areas of the city.

Staying in Secaucus is no closer driving to that bindery yet it puts you much further from Manhattan and requires your using a bus which is subject to traffic delays.
